Templates
(Menu 1.4)
Using this menu, you can preset up to five messages
that you use most frequently. Scroll through the
template list using the
required message template is highlighted, press the
Options soft key.
Edit: allows you to write a new message or edit the
selected message.
Note: For information on how to enter characters,
refer to page 43.
Send Message: allows you to recall the selected
message. Once you have completed the message,
you can send, save and send, or simply save it. For
details on how to send a message, see page 66.
Delete: allows you to delete the selected message.
You are asked to confirm the deletion by pressing
the Yes soft key.

Settings
(Menu 1.5)
Via this menu, you can set up default SMS
information. A setting group is a collection of
settings required to send messages. The number of
setting groups available depends on the capacity of
your SIM card.
Setting x (where x is the setting group number):
each group has its own sub-menu.
Service Centre: allows you to store or change the
number of your SMS centre required when sending
messages. You must obtain this number from your
service provider.
Default Destination: allows you to store the default
destination number. The number will automatically
be displayed on the Destination screen when you
create a message.
Default Type: allows you to set the default message
type (Text, Fax, E-mail and Paging). The network
can convert the messages into the selected format.
Default Validity: allows you to set the length of time
for which your text messages will be stored at the
message centre while attempts are made to deliver
them.
Setting Name: allows you to give a name to the
setting group currently being defined.
Common Setting: the following options are
available.
Reply Path: allows the recipient of your SMS
message to send you a reply message via your
message centre, if the service is provided by the
network.
